Gas Detonation Costs Three Carabinieri While Executing Property Removal Operation in Northern Italy

Scene of the explosion event
All three victimized officers were part of the military police

A trio of officers lost their lives and at least 15 others were hurt in what appears to be premeditated blast caused by gas at a farmhouse in Italy's north.

Event Timeline

The explosion took place as law enforcement and fire personnel entered the residence in the vicinity of the Verona region to carry out an removal notice for two brothers and a sister aged in their 50s and 60s.

The three deceased individuals were members of the Carabinieri military police.

Arrests and Aftermath

Two individuals were taken into custody at the scene and another man who escaped following the explosion was apprehended shortly later. The trio have been transported to hospital.

The explosion could be audible as far as 3 miles distant and footage from the scene showed the structure left as a pile of rubble.

“This is a time for grieving,” stated Interior Minister Matteo Piantedosi, who added that efforts had been made to remove the three family members in the past.

Financial Context

The president of the region of Veneto, Luca Zaia, stated the farmhouse was subject to an eviction order due to unpaid amounts accrued by the three owners.

Negotiators had been sent to speak to the family members who had locked themselves into the home. When the officers arrived soon after 03:00 (01:00 GMT), officials suspect a family member triggered the blast.

“Upon entering the house, we were confronted with an act of absolute madness,” regional commander Claudio Papagno informed reporters.

A gas canister had been ignited, and the blast immediately struck our personnel,” he explained.

Petrol bombs were also located at the residence, the interior minister said.

Casualties and Damage

Injured individuals by the incident comprised eleven more officers of the police force as well as three officers of national police and a firefighter.

According to the prosecuting attorney, the property was in a dilapidated shape and had was without power.

The prosecutor was convinced the explosion had occurred on a floor above the doorway and stated to the press it was a “deliberate and pre-planned murder”. Shortly before the incident, he revealed members had “heard a whistle, presumably the propane tanks being activated”.

Community Reaction

“All of us understood the scenario was critical,” local residents informed Italian media, mentioning that the family members had in the past stated to “blow themselves up” rather than vacate the property.

“The explosion had left a ‘terrible, very painful and dramatic toll’.”

Minister of Defence Guido Crosetto stood alongside other political leaders in commemorating the three men who had died in the performance of their duties.
